Caunitz, author of One Police Plaza William J. Coughlin has combined a career as a United States administrative judge in Detroit with that of a best-selling novelist. His four previous highly acclaimed and successful novels are The Twelve Apostles, His Father’s Daughter, In the Presence of Enemies and Shadow of a Doubt."synopsis" may belong to another edition of this title.
